Not only that, but because these applications could possibly be listening for beacons continuously, there is certainly also a threat of incidental data selection. Most companies that create and/or use this "ultrasonic cross-device tracking" technology mention that they do not store any documents of audible audio, They are only listening for distinct higher-frequency pitches. But As with all "often on" sensing technology, the door is open up for misuse.

British isles supermarket Waitrose started off utilizing iBeacon technology at its somewhat new experimental Swindon store to provide price promotions to shoppers every time they had been in the vicinity of a specific aisle or food items counter. The beacon-enabled Waitrose app also lets a customer to scan barcodes, read through customer reviews of merchandise, add things to the virtual buying basket, and pay back by way of a cell wallet.
